Give the Phone a Rest
In today’s technology-driven world, distractions and interruptions are constantly around us. Take the time to focus on being present with your child – both physically and emotionally. Simple, brain-building activities like talking, reading books, and singing songs together are wonderful ways to connect and bond with your child every day. Talk. Read. Sing. It changes everything®
